Hardmoors 26.2: Roseberry

Guisborough, United Kingdom • 30 Aug 2026

Event details

The Hardmoors 26.2 Roseberry Trail Races take place on Sunday 30 August 2026 at Sea Cadets Hall, Belmangate, Guisborough TS14 7AQ. The event capacity is 400 entrants. Parking at the registration venue is very limited and nearby car parks are recommended. Entries open 2 November 2025 and close 14 August 2026. Entry fees vary by status and distance.

  • Trail Marathon - ascent 4850 ft, time limit 10 hours
  • Half Marathon - ascent 3200 ft, time limit 5 hours
  • Trail 10k - ascent 1600 ft, time limit 3 hours

Race rules and kit

All routes are not fully marked; competitors receive downloadable route descriptions, maps and GPX files and must navigate themselves. Foot sweepers and marshals operate on the course; if a runner retires they should go to the next checkpoint for assistance.

Mandatory kit is required for all races and will be checked. Required items include a waterproof jacket with taped seams, hat, gloves, spare long-sleeved base layer, 500 ml water or sports drink, printed route description and map, emergency survival bag and foil blanket, whistle and a way to attach the race number. Marathon runners must also carry a headtorch. The event is cupless at checkpoints. Prize categories cover male, female, veteran age groups and non-binary entrants. Several entry and refund rules apply, including no standard refunds or deferrals; transfers are limited by closing dates and race full status.
